7-Day Itinerary: Exploring Pattya and Phuket

Friday, September 15: Arrival in Pattya

Welcome to Pattya! After arriving at the airport, check-in at your preferred hotel. Spend the morning relaxing at the beautiful Pattya Beach, enjoying the warm sun and crystal-clear waters. In the afternoon, visit the Sanctuary of Truth, an awe-inspiring wooden temple showcasing intricate carvings. In the evening, explore the vibrant Walking Street, filled with lively bars, street performances, and delicious street food.

  • Pattya Beach: Free, 3-4 hours
  • Sanctuary of Truth: THB 500 (approx.), 2-3 hours
  • Walking Street: Free (expenses vary), 2-3 hours
Saturday, September 16: Pattya City Exploration

Start your day by visiting the Nong Nooch Tropical Garden, known for its beautifully landscaped gardens and fascinating Thai cultural shows. In the afternoon, indulge in some retail therapy at the CentralFestival Pattaya Beach, a popular shopping mall. In the evening, enjoy the Alcazar Cabaret Show, a dazzling performance featuring extravagant costumes and live music.

  • Nong Nooch Tropical Garden: THB 500 (approx.), 3-4 hours
  • CentralFestival Pattaya Beach: Expenses vary, 2-3 hours
  • Alcazar Cabaret Show: THB 600 (approx.), 2 hours
Sunday, September 17: Island Hopping in Pattya

Embark on an exciting island hopping adventure today. Take a speedboat tour to the scenic Coral Island, where you can snorkel, swim, or simply relax on the pristine beaches.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Koh Larn Island, known for its picturesque viewpoints and water sports activities. Enjoy the stunning sunset views before heading back to Pattya.

  • Coral Island Tour: THB 1,000 (approx.), 6-8 hours
  • Koh Larn Island: THB 300 (approx.), 3-4 hours
Monday, September 18: Travel to Phuket

Today, it's time to bid farewell to Pattya and travel to the beautiful island of Phuket. Catch a flight or take a bus to Phuket and check-in at your preferred hotel. Spend the day exploring Phuket Old Town, known for its vibrant street art, charming architecture, and local markets. Don't forget to indulge in some delicious street food along the way.

  • Flight/Bus to Phuket: Prices vary, travel time varies
  • Phuket Old Town: Free, 2-3 hours
Tuesday, September 19: Island Paradise in Phuket

Today, set sail on a full-day tour to the world-famous Phi Phi Islands. Marvel at the stunning limestone cliffs, swim in crystal-clear waters, and snorkel among colorful marine life. Explore Maya Bay, made famous by the movie "The Beach." Enjoy a delicious beachside lunch and soak up the tropical paradise vibes.

  • Phi Phi Islands Tour: THB 1,500 (approx.), 8-10 hours
Wednesday, September 20: Phuket Adventure Day

Get ready for an adrenaline-filled day! Start by visiting the Big Buddha, a majestic landmark offering panoramic views of Phuket. In the afternoon, take a thrilling ATV ride through the jungle or go ziplining through the treetops. Wrap up the day by exploring the vibrant Patong Beach area, filled with shops, restaurants, and nightlife.

  • Big Buddha: Free, 2-3 hours
  • ATV Ride/Ziplining: THB 1,000 (approx.), 2-3 hours
  • Patong Beach: Free (expenses vary), 2-3 hours
Thursday, September 21: Phuket Beaches and Sunset

Spend your last full day in Phuket by exploring its stunning beaches. Start with a visit to Kamala Beach, known for its tranquility and beautiful views. In the afternoon, head to Surin Beach, a popular spot for sunbathing and swimming. End the day with a mesmerizing sunset at Promthep Cape, a viewpoint offering breathtaking panoramic vistas.

  • Kamala Beach: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Surin Beach: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Promthep Cape: Free,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Pattya and Phuket, don't miss out on these hidden gems and local favorites. In Pattya, visit the Art in Paradise Museum, an interactive 3D art gallery that allows you to become a part of the artwork. In Phuket, check out the Banzaan Fresh Market, a bustling local market where you can sample delicious Thai street food and shop for fresh produce, seafood, and souvenirs.
